This analysis examines four elementary schools in the 76087 zip code, serving communities in Weatherford, Brock, and Willow Park, Texas, across three highly-rated independent school districts: Weatherford Independent School District (Isd), Brock Independent School District (Isd), and Aledo Independent School District (Isd).
McCall Elementary (Aledo ISD) stands out as the highest-performing school overall, with top-tier test scores and a district ranked in the 99th percentile. Brock Intermediate (Brock ISD) is an efficiency champion, achieving similarly excellent results with the lowest per-student spending ($7,719) and highest student-teacher ratio (15.3:1). Martin Elementary (Weatherford ISD) is a value-add school, significantly outperforming its district averages despite having the highest free/reduced lunch rate (29.98%). Brock Elementary (Brock ISD) also performs well within its efficient district model.
Key metrics show that socioeconomic status is not a perfect predictor of performance, as Martin Elementary achieves strong results despite higher poverty levels. Science scores are a differentiator, with McCall Elementary (53.33%) and Brock Intermediate (46.11%) far exceeding the state average (29.57%), while Martin Elementary (30.77%) is closer to the state average. Overall, families in this area have access to multiple excellent elementary schools, each with distinct strengths: McCall for top-tier performance, Brock for efficiency, and Martin for exceptional value-add education within its district.
